JPMorgan Chase: The U.S. Government Efficiency Department's advancement of federal reform may face obstacles

Bitget2024/11/25 01:31

JPMorgan recently released a report assessing the U.S. Government Efficiency Department (DOGE). This department was established by President-elect Trump and is led by Elon Musk and Vivek Ramaswamy, with the aim of streamlining federal operations and reducing wasteful spending. The report states: "In terms of government efficiency, Trump is expected to push an agenda advocating for less bureaucracy. This includes establishing a new Government Efficiency Department," adding that "We believe it will be difficult for this department to achieve this."

JPMorgan explained the potential obstacles DOGE may encounter: "Ultimately, Congress controls government spending, while DOGE operates outside of Congress. The department can make all the recommendations it wants, but in the end it's typically a 60-vote majority in Congress that decides legislative changes." The report concluded: "The question investors care most about in 2025 is which parts of the Trump 2.0 agenda will be emphasized and which parts will gradually fade away."
